The single-valued membership of fuzzy sets make it can’t process and describefuzzy information well. Therefore, in1986, Atanassov expands the theory of classicalfuzzy set, and the intuitionistic fuzzy set is proposed. In1993, W.L.G au and D.J.Buehrer proposed the Vague sets, As another generalizing theory of the fuzzy sets, Itis completely studied with intuitionistic fuzzy set in theory, there is just a slightdifference between the manifestations. Compared to the fuzzy sets, they can be moredelicate and flexible representation and processing fuzzy information, also theyprovide a powerful measurement tools to deal with information and decision-making.On the basis of the theoretical knowledge of the Fuzzy Sets,a comparative studyof intuitionistic fuzzy sets and fuzzy set which enriched the basic theoreticalknowledge of intuitionistic fuzzy sets,Also we research the Intuitionistic fuzzyentropytheory and use the intuitionistic fuzzy entropy in multi-attribute fuzzy decision. Thispaper is mainly involving the following tasks:First, the theoretical basis of knowledge management of fuzzy sets andintuitionistic fuzzy sets is presented, and it gives a brief introduction of the story oftheir properties and algorithms. Second, the entropy of intuitionistic fuzzy sets isstudied. We analysis the existing problems of the intuitionistic fuzzy entropy,then weamend the intuitionistic fuzzy entropy based on the probability entropy on Shannonand a new solving formula of intuitionistic fuzzy entropy is proposed, which fullyconsidered the influence of the degree of hesitation ambiguity. this research willprovide people helping them to understand and describe the ambiguity problems,also an example is making to prove the practicability and validity of the formula.Third, we investigate the relationship between fuzzy entropy relationship similarity measure and distance measure on intuitionistic fuzzy set theory based on learning themutual transformation relationship between the three metrics, then we prove it. Forth,The entropy of intuitionistic fuzzy sets in the application of multiple attribute groupdecision making problems is investigated,One important part of Multiple attributedecision making is to enable the weight of indicators. Whether rational to determinethe index weight directly influences the accuracy and scientificalness of the results ofmultiobjective decision.Analytic Hierarchy Process (AHP) and expert evaluationmethod with a certain degree of subjective and arbitrary, and therefore will affect theaccuracy and reliability of the agent’s decision.In this paper, we use the new intuitivefuzzy entropy formula which is proposed for the index attribute empowerment,Itfully exploits the information contained in the original data, so the evaluation resultsshould be more mathematical theoretical basis and more overall.Therefore, amultiple attribute decision making model based on intuitionistic fuzzy entropy arebuilt up.Finally, the instance of the comprehensive evaluation of a University LibraryReader Satisfaction was studied,which verify the practicability and effectiveness ofthis model.
